Suzie is a 16 year old whippet/terrier cross who was taken to a vet by her original family to be put to sleep.

It seems her only crime was to have grown old and they had tired of her.

 

Fortunately the vet decided that Suzie should be saved and instead of putting her down he asked Milosmum if she was still involved with Gap and would they help. So very kindly Lisa came to the rescue of this great little lady

 

Susie lept like a log overnight, Ray stayed with her in the living room and she whined to go out at about 06:30, did what she needed, then toddled in climbed on a couple of the big beds and went to sleep again.

 

 

She seems to have a self inflicted sore on her bum and is and she's quite obsessive with it Hoping to find something to stop her doing it as it is quite nasty.

 

She's been fine with the cats, but does try to run after them if they run past her and I think she would come off worse if she tried to catch them

 

She's wearing Cushna's puppy collar at the moment (rather than her tatty blue one), but we are going to get her a pretty little one asap.

 

We've been for a walk that was over 1hr and she had no problem doing the whole thing, in fact the greys had their usual after walk nap, Susie has kept us on our toes. :)

 

All in all she's doing well.
